Potential effect of anti-inflammatory drug use on PSA kinetics and subsequent prostate cancer diagnosis: Risk stratification in black and white men with benign prostate biopsy

BACKGROUND: Rising prostate-specific antigen (PSA) levels are associated with both increased risk of prostate cancer and prostatic inflammation. The confounding effects of inflammation on the utility of PSA kinetics to predict prostate cancer may be partially mitigated by anti-inflammatory drug use....
